Fully remote and autonomous position providing infusions in the home setting for patients in the Charleston, WV area.
As a Home Infusion IVIG Registered Nurse (RN), you will work outside the walls of a hospital setting in a growing specialized area of the nursing field. If you are spending 12 hours on your feet or rushing from patient to patient with no time to provide quality patient care, this would be the perfect opportunity to change your work environment. Our nurses have the luxury of having a work-life balance. Their work schedule also provides an opportunity to build one-on-one relationships with their patients.
In this PRN role, you will visit patients in greater Charleston and surrounding areas with occasional travel of up to 150-200 miles one way. Travel time is paid and mileage is reimbursed.
